What are some examples of sustainable technology being implemented in the restaurant industry?5answers

Sustainable technology in the restaurant industry includes the adoption of QR code menus, sourcing ingredients from local and organic farms, and implementing mobile payment systems like NFC. QR code menus reduce paper waste, lower carbon footprint, and align with UN Sustainable Development Goals . Restaurants are increasingly focusing on sustainability by obtaining ingredients locally, reducing energy and water use, and promoting recycling and composting . Mobile payment systems, particularly NFC, enhance restaurant operating performance by improving sales growth, cost savings, flexibility, accessibility, and trust & safety, especially for smaller establishments . Additionally, consumers worldwide appreciate sustainable practices like health protocols, open spaces, local ingredients, and eco-friendly facilities in restaurants, although sustainability is not the primary factor influencing their choice of dining establishments .

What are the benefits and challenges of using technology for competitive advantage in the fast food chain?5answers

Blockchain technology has the potential to revolutionize the food supply chain by increasing transparency and traceability . It can help overcome challenges such as quality control, food fraud, and maintenance . By providing a transparent and traceable digital ledger of transactions and movements, blockchain technology can improve quality assessment, increase product transparency and traceability, and enable sophisticated fraud detection capabilities . However, there are also challenges associated with implementing blockchain technology in the food supply chain, such as trust issues, subpar performance, and the need to disrupt traditional supply chain operations . Despite these challenges, the deployment of a blockchain-based system has the potential to significantly increase the efficiency, transparency, and traceability of the food supply chain .

How adoption of technology affect overall organizational performance in food industry?5answers

The adoption of technology in the food industry has a positive impact on overall organizational performance. Advanced technologies such as computer-based information and control systems, sophisticated processing and packaging methods, and digital supply chains enhance product quality, improve food safety, reduce costs, and increase supply chain agility . Additionally, the adoption of technology enables the production of ad hoc reports, improves the quality of work, facilitates knowledge sharing, and empowers employees . Performing firms that have adopted advanced technology perceive more benefits and fewer obstacles related to knowledge and people, leading to more favorable technology adoption behavior . The use of blockchain technology in the food industry also positively influences decision-making processes, information sharing, and traceability of goods . Overall, the adoption of technology in the food industry improves performance by enhancing efficiency, transparency, standardization, and platform development .
